在当今的互联网环境中,云服务器的安全性变得越来越重要。其中一种常见的威胁是暴力破解攻击,它是指攻击者通过尝试所有可能的密码组合来猜测用户密码。为了确保您的云服务器免受此类攻击,本文将提供一系列有效的防护措施。
1. 使用强密码策略
复杂且独特的密码:建议为每个账户设置足够长(至少12个字符)、包含大小写字母、数字以及特殊符号的密码,并避免使用容易被猜到的信息如生日或姓名作为密码的一部分。
2. 启用多因素认证(MFA)
增加额外验证步骤:除了传统的用户名和密码外,还可以启用MFA功能,在登录时要求用户提供第二种形式的身份验证信息,例如手机短信验证码、硬件令牌或者生物识别等。这可以大大提高系统的安全性,即使密码泄露了也不容易被利用。
3. 限制失败登录次数
阻止恶意尝试:配置服务器以限制连续错误输入密码的最大次数。一旦达到这个阈值,就暂时锁定该IP地址一段时间,从而减少暴力破解成功的可能性。
4. 监控异常活动并及时响应
实时检测与预警机制:安装专业的日志分析工具或服务,对系统访问记录进行持续监控。当发现大量来自同一来源地的非法请求或其他可疑行为时,立即采取行动,如更改密码、禁用相关账号或调整防火墙规则。
5. 更新软件补丁及插件
保持最新状态:定期检查操作系统、应用程序及其依赖库是否存在已知漏洞,并尽快应用官方发布的修复程序。同时也要关注第三方组件的安全公告,确保所使用的插件都是经过严格审核并且来自可信源。
6. 隐藏SSH端口
改变默认连接方式:对于Linux系统来说,默认情况下SSH服务会监听22号端口。但是由于这是众所周知的目标位置,因此很容易成为黑客的重点攻击对象。我们可以通过修改配置文件来改变这一情况,选择一个不常用的端口号,并确保只有必要的设备能够访问此端口。
7. 禁止root远程登录
降低风险:直接允许root用户从外部网络登录存在较大安全隐患。最好的做法是创建普通权限的新用户来进行日常操作,必要时再通过sudo命令获得更高权限。这样即便有人突破防线也无法轻易控制整个服务器。
8. 定期备份重要数据
以防万一:尽管上述措施可以在很大程度上抵御暴力破解攻击,但没有任何防御体系是绝对完美的。养成良好的数据备份习惯至关重要。将关键文件存储在多个地理位置分散的位置,以便在网络遭受破坏后能够迅速恢复业务。
保护云服务器免遭暴力破解攻击需要综合运用多种技术和管理手段。遵循以上建议可以帮助您构建更坚固的安全屏障,保障业务稳定运行和个人隐私不受侵犯。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/47627.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。